Coronavirus: Two more deaths reported on April 25
On April 25, 328 people tested positive for coronavirus in Uzbekistan, bringing the total number of cases to 89,355.
The Ministry of Health said that 174 cases were registered in the city of Tashkent, 5 – in Andijan, 8 – in Bukhara, 5 – in Jizzakh, 3 – in Navoi, 6 – in Namangan, 43 – in Samarkand, 5 – in Syrdarya, 10 – in Surkhandarya, 1 – in Fergana, 1 – in Khorezm and 67 – in Tashkent region.
Yesterday, April 25, 2 patients died from the disease. The death toll stands at 645.
“85,976 people have recovered from coronavirus in the country so far,” the ministry said.
Currently, 2,734 patients are being treated in hospitals, 238 of them are in serious and 113 – in critical condition.
